TheLE postcode area,also known as theLeicester postcode area,[2]is a group of 21 postcode districts incentral England,within 12post towns.These cover most ofLeicestershire(includingLeicester,Loughborough,Hinckley,Melton Mowbray,Coalville,Market Harborough,Ashby de la Zouch,Lutterworth,Wigston,MarkfieldandIbstock) and most ofRutland(includingOakham), plus small parts of southNottinghamshireand northNorthamptonshire,and very small parts ofDerbyshireandWarwickshire.
Coverage
[edit]The approximate coverage of the postcode districts:
The LE65 and LE67 districts were formed from LE6 circa 1992.
The LE19 district was formed in 2002 from parts of the LE3 and LE9 districts.[3]
The LE2, LE3 and LE4 postcode districts are all among the top five by population.[4]
